Hyper-Personalization: Unveiling the Path to Building Lasting Customer Loyalty

In today’s fiercely competitive marketplace, businesses must go beyond traditional marketing strategies to foster lasting customer loyalty. One of the key strategies emerging as a frontrunner in this endeavor is hyper-personalization. This article will explore the significance of hyper-personalization in building customer loyalty, while delving into its fundamental aspects and the impact it has on customer lifetime value.

Commitment to Content and Brand Interactions

To establish a deep connection with customers, brands must commit to delivering fresh and relevant content. Hyper-personalization demands a comprehensive understanding of individual preferences and a dedication to serving each customer on a personal level. By leveraging customer data and tailoring interactions accordingly, brands can create an ecosystem that resonates with each customer’s unique needs and preferences.

Increased Customer Lifetime Value

The true value of hyper-personalization lies in its ability to enhance customer lifetime value. By constantly delivering personalized experiences, brands create a sense of loyalty and trust, ultimately increasing the likelihood of repeat purchases and building long-term customer relationships. The cumulative effect of hyper-personalization manifests in improved customer retention rates and increased advocacy among satisfied customers.

Crafting Memorable Experiences

To elevate loyalty programs, businesses must focus on crafting memorable experiences that foster a positive emotional connection with consumers. Generic approaches to rewards programs often fall short, lacking the desired impact. By personalizing rewards and experiences based on individual preferences, brands can create experiences that resonate deeply with each customer. This emotional connection goes beyond transactional interactions, securing a place in the customer’s heart.

The Role of Technology

Advancements in technology have significantly streamlined the execution of hyper-personalization strategies. Integration of apps and online platforms allows consumers to list their preferences and provide their relevant information, enabling brands to deliver a more personalized shopping experience. The seamless integration of technology not only enhances customer satisfaction but also facilitates the collection and analysis of data, enabling brands to refine their personalization efforts.

Standing Out in Loyalty Programs

As customers increasingly seek personalized experiences and emotional connections with brands, loyalty programs must rise above generic approaches to create a lasting impact. Hyper-personalization allows brands to differentiate themselves by connecting with individuals on a personal level. By understanding customer preferences, anticipating their needs, and delivering tailored rewards and experiences, brands can cultivate loyalty that transcends mere transactional interactions.

In conclusion, hyper-personalization has emerged as a leading trend in building sustained customer loyalty. By committing to understanding and serving individuals on a personal level, brands can forge deep connections, enhance customer lifetime value, and stand out in loyalty programs. With advancements in technology empowering businesses to execute personalization strategies more effectively, the importance of this approach cannot be overstated. As the marketplace continues to evolve, hyper-personalization will be a key differentiator in cultivating long-term customer loyalty. Embracing this strategy is not just a choice but rather a commitment to creating meaningful, personalized experiences that leave a lasting impression.
